[Date Prev][Date Next][Thread Prev][Thread Next][Date Index][Thread Index]

Re: [Simple] New IM-specific feature



I can foresee some disadvantage of using Presence for this as follows.
1. Adds more overhead as an explicit and periodic subscription is required (i.e Events and extension to presence). 2. Presence fits situation where IM sender (as watcher) gets information about IM recipient (as presentity), here the situation is reverse. 3. Will not allow user to choose from different option (QA) avaliable in real-time. 4. I may want to send some QA to those who are not my 'watchers' (because they don't care about my presence information) but v.important to me e.g HR delegate from a probable employer :-) 5. For page-mode delivery, subscribing to the right user agent and set of messages may not be easy.

We can consider these QA somewhat analogous to multimedia message-templates in current messaging(SMS, MMS, ...) system which is usefull and widely used. User can themselves create them for future use.

Regards
Deepanshu



----- Original Message ----- From: "Ben Campbell" <ben at nostrum.com>
To: "Deepanshu Gautam" <deepanshu at huawei.com>; "Simple WG" <simple at ietf.org>
Cc: "Paul Kyzivat" <pkyzivat at cisco.com>
Sent: Tuesday, August 11, 2009 11:26 AM
Subject: Re: [Simple] New IM-specific feature


(as individual)

I concur with Paul's opinion (and questions).

To expand a bit, while I have seen some IM systems with this function,
its utility seems weak in a _presence_ and IM system. That is, the  sort
of information one might put into a QA is better communicated as  part of
presence state. IMO, this sort of thing is exactly what the  presence
distribution mechanism was designed for.


On Aug 10, 2009, at 5:44 PM, Paul Kyzivat wrote:

Inline...

Deepanshu Gautam wrote:
Dear All,

I would like to propose a new IM-specific feature for SIMPLE, which i
would call as "Quick Answer(QA)". Allow me to explain about it  briefly.

In instant messaging system, it is useful to have some readily
available
IM (text, audio or video) which can be sent in case of the receiver  is
too busy to type/speak/record for a reply. User can create and  store IM
(QA) using a particular client device and can use them when required.
Creating and then storing on a single device may not be very useful
because user can log-in a particular IM system using different client
devices at different point of time. In that case QA created using one
client device will not be available to another client device.

I would like to propose a draft to solve this problem and perform the
needed standardization, which will further make this IM-feature
possible. Before moving forward I would like to get some initial
comment
from the group about this idea. You comments would be valuable.

Where do you imagine this new state would be stored?
And who/what would use it?

Are you proposing a "database" that is shared by the various UAs for  an
AOR, that they would each update and retrieve from?

Would the sending of the answer still depend on a UA receiving the
message? Or do you expect that the answer will be sent even if there  is
no UA registered?

IMO this doesn't fit well with the simple model.

Thanks,
Paul

Regards
Deepanshu Gautam


------------------------------------------------------------------------

_______________________________________________
Simple mailing list
Simple at ietf.org
https://www.ietf.org/mailman/listinfo/simple
_______________________________________________
Simple mailing list
Simple at ietf.org
https://www.ietf.org/mailman/listinfo/simple